    For all you HK91/PTR91/CETME owners out there, what Rifle folding/collapsible stocks have you tied? I think the German issue collapsible stock definitely has the cool factor but I have read it is punishing to shoot. The Choate folder might be the more ergonomic option. Are there any other choices besides those two?

    I've been thinking of getting one of the Choate folding stocks for my PTR 91, but haven't tried anything other that the normal stock though. There are two different types of Choate folders. The regular one and one that has removable spacers to change the length. The different sites that had them have good reviews for them.

    I read that the "meat tenderizer" collapsible stock does not shorten the overall length as much as the Choate side folders, is not as comfortable, and is much more expensive.

    I also see there is a M4 style retractable stock.

    I have a Choate folder for my 10/22 (complete stock) and it is very well made and comfortable. Course the 10/22 does not have the kick of a 308 either.
